Tourism in Slovakia saw positive trends last year and is expected to grow further in 2019, according to Tourism Association President Marek Harbulak, as quoted by the TASR press agency. "Domestic tourism performance is expected to grow at more than 10 percent this year," he said, adding that Slovakia is now able to make better use of the growing demand and attract more foreign visitors. "Strengthening interest in domestic tourism with bonuses for pupils during ski courses and stays in the country, as well as with recreational vouchers, will increase the number of domestic guests this year as well as in future years," concluded Harbulak.
